Understanding Business Checking Accounts
A business checking account is designed specifically to meet the unique needs of businesses, offering a range of valuable features. These accounts typically include higher transaction limits, the option to issue employee cards, and tools to streamline managing receivables and payables. Additionally, they often provide opportunities to connect with local businesses and access exclusive perks offered by community banks.

Understanding Fees and Costs
When selecting a business checking account, it’s essential to understand the associated fees. These may include monthly service charges, transaction fees, and penalties for overdrafts. To avoid unexpected costs, carefully review the fine print and inquire about all potential fees upfront. Clear knowledge of these details can help you make an informed decision and steer clear of surprises later.

Setting Up Your Account
After selecting a bank, opening a business checking account is usually a simple process, provided you have the necessary documents ready. These typically include your business license, EIN, and personal identification. Being well-prepared and working with a knowledgeable bank representative who understands your business needs can make the experience seamless and efficient.
Maintaining Your Account
Once your account is set up, proper maintenance is key. This includes regularly monitoring transactions, reconciling your account each month, and staying informed about any updates to banking terms or fees. By reviewing your account consistently, you can keep your finances organized and avoid potential problems like overdraft charges or fraudulent activity.
